Cherrywood Golf Club

Cherrywood Golf Club, situated in Ottawa Lake, Michigan, is undeniably a hidden gem for golfers at any skill level. Established in 1973 and designed by Bob Wall, this 9-hole public course is a short drive from Toledo, Ann Arbor, and Detroit, making it a convenient spot for a quick escape or a weekend round.

The course itself is well-maintained, with lush fairways and greens that challenge even seasoned players. The rough can be particularly daunting, so accuracy off the tee is crucial. The layout of 2759 yards from the longest tees adds to the challenge while still being accessible for less experienced golfers. Cherrywood’s par 35 course offers strategic play with both par 3s and par 4s, including the tricky par 5 ninth hole, which can make or break your round.

Cherrywood has modest yet sufficient amenities; they offer rental clubs, carts, and have a pro shop where you can pick up essentials. The dress code is quite relaxed, in line with the vibe stated by the T-shirt on display: 'No collar, no problem. No A-game, no problem.' This mantra is mirrored in the overall atmosphere of the club, encouraging golfers to focus on the enjoyment of the game rather than strict formalities.

Regarding booking and tee times, unlike many other clubs, Cherrywood doesn’t require pre-booking. This is great for spontaneous golfers, but it’s best to call ahead during peak times to ensure availability. The rates are very reasonable, ranging from $8 to $17 depending on weekdays and weekends.

One aspect that stands out is the community feel of Cherrywood. Regulars love the senior men's scrambles on Wednesday and Friday mornings at 10 AM—an excellent opportunity to meet a friendly bunch of local golfers. If you value camaraderie on the course, this is an event you definitely won't want to miss.

If you're planning to visit, do note that Cherrywood does not accept credit cards, so be prepared with cash for green fees and any on-course purchases. They do offer special rates for juniors, seniors, and twilight times, so it's worth checking these out if you fall into any of these categories.
